    Description

    Key Responsibilities:

    • Perform structural analysis and engineering calculations for commercial and institutional building projects.

    • Design structural systems utilizing steel, reinforced concrete, wood, and masonry.

    • Prepare structural construction drawings, specifications, and engineering documentation.

    • Review and interpret structural calculations, drawings, and design documents.

    • Conduct field observations and construction site inspections involving steel, concrete, masonry, and wood structural systems.

    • Prepare clear, concise, and technically accurate engineering reports.

    • Coordinate with architects, project managers, contractors, owners, and multidisciplinary engineering teams.

    • Mentor and provide technical guidance to Engineers-in-Training (EITs).

    • Ensure designs comply with applicable building codes, industry standards, and engineering best practices.

    • Support project planning, quality assurance, and successful project delivery.

    Required Qualifications:

    • Bachelor's Degree in Civil Engineering with a Structural Engineering emphasis or related discipline.

    • Active Professional Engineer (PE) license.

    • Strong knowledge of:

      • Structural Analysis

      • Steel Design

      • Reinforced Concrete Design

      • Wood Design

      • Masonry Design

      • Mechanics of Materials

    • Ability to prepare and review structural calculations, engineering reports, and construction documents.

    • Strong communication, organizational, and collaboration skills.

    Preferred Technical Skills:

    Experience with one or more of the following software:

    • Revit

    • RAM Structural System

    • RISA

    • Enercalc
